> > The capture_crc() function validates that the CRC frame sequence
> > returned by igt_pipe_crc_get_for_frame() matches the expected
> > value.
> > The current check uses exact equality (!=), however the library
> > function igt_pipe_crc_get_for_frame() uses >= comparison
> > internally:
> >
> > do {
> > read_one_crc(pipe_crc, crc);
> > ...
> > } while (igt_vblank_before(crc->frame, vblank));
> >
> > The function loops while crc->frame < vblank, returning the first
> > CRC where crc->frame >= expected, not necessarily an exact match.
> >
> > This strict validation can cause test failures on drivers that
> > report CRC entries with frame sequences larger than expected. This
> > happens when drivers use internal queuing mechanisms to ensure CRC
> > values are correctly correlated with their corresponding frames.
> >
> > Example without internal queue (continuous CRC reporting):
> > - Driver generates CRC entries continuously every frame
> > - Frame sequence increments sequentially
> > - Test finds exact matches for all expected frames → PASS
> >
> > Example with internal queue (per-commit CRC reporting):
> > - Driver queues CRC and reports with current frame sequence
> > - Due to queue processing delay, reported sequence > expected
> > - For the last CRC, test adds +1 to expected (per IGT logic)
> > - Library's >= comparison returns valid CRC
> > - capture_crc's != check fails on last frame → FAIL
> >
> > Relax the validation to use < comparison instead of !=, which:
> > 1. Aligns with igt_pipe_crc_get_for_frame() internal behavior
> > 2. Accepts CRC entries with frame >= expected (valid cases)
> > 3. Still catches real errors where frame < expected, indicating
> > CRC buffer overflow or stale data
> >

> Agree on the concept, but with that then isn't this check itself
> redundant as this has been taken care of already in the
> 'igt_pipe_crc_get_for_frame'?
>
> static inline bool igt_vblank_before(uint32_t a, uint32_t b)
> {
> return igt_vblank_after(b, a);
> }
>
Hi Karthik,
You're right. Since igt_pipe_crc_get_for_frame() internally loops
with igt_vblank_before(crc->frame, vblank), it already guarantees
crc->frame >= vblank upon return. The < vblank check in capture_crc()
would never trigger under normal conditions, making it redundant.
I've removed the entire frame sequence validation in capture_crc()
and will rely on the library's existing guarantee. Will update the
patch accordingly.
